HR Business Partners play a crucial role in ensuring organizational compliance with employment laws and regulations. Drafting clear and effective compliance notices is essential to communicate policies, legal updates, and procedural changes to employees. Utilizing strategic prompts can significantly enhance the quality and accuracy of these notices.
Understanding the Importance of Effective Prompts
Effective prompts serve as guiding questions or instructions that help HR professionals focus on key information when drafting compliance notices. Well-crafted prompts ensure that notices are comprehensive, clear, and legally sound, reducing misunderstandings and potential legal risks.
Strategies for Crafting Effective Prompts
1. Be Specific and Clear
Use precise language in prompts to direct attention to critical details such as legal requirements, deadlines, and affected parties. For example, instead of asking, “What should be included?”, specify, “Include the specific legal regulation violated, the affected employee group, and the corrective action required.”
2. Focus on Key Compliance Areas
Design prompts that target essential compliance topics such as anti-discrimination policies, workplace safety, data privacy, and wage laws. This focus ensures that notices cover all necessary legal bases.
3. Incorporate Relevant Legal Language
Encourage the inclusion of precise legal terminology and references to statutes or regulations. Prompts should remind HR partners to verify the accuracy of legal citations to maintain credibility and compliance.
Examples of Effective Prompts for Drafting Notices
- Identify the specific regulation or policy that has been violated.
- Describe the impact of the violation on the organization and employees.
- Specify the corrective actions required and the timeline for compliance.
- Include references to relevant legal statutes or guidelines.
- Use clear, professional language suitable for all employees.
Best Practices for HR Business Partners
To maximize the effectiveness of prompts, HR Business Partners should:
- Regularly update prompts based on changes in laws and organizational policies.
- Collaborate with legal counsel to verify the accuracy of legal references.
- Use templates and checklists to maintain consistency across notices.
- Seek feedback from employees and legal experts to improve clarity and effectiveness.
